Chapter 38 contains requirements for private water well construction permits, including test wells and monitoring wells.
Chapter 39 contains requirements for the proper closure or abandonment of wells.

Chapter 41 contains the drinking water standards and specific monitoring requirements for the public water supply program.
Chapter 42 contains the public notification, public education, consumer confidence reporting, and record-keeping requirements for the public water supply program.
Chapter 43 contains specific design, construction, fee, operating, and operation permit requirements for the public water supply program.

Chapter 49 contains the nonpublic water supply well requirements.
Chapters 50 to 52 contain the provisions for water withdrawal and allocation.
Chapter 55 contains the provisions for public water supply aquifer storage and recovery.
Chapter 81 contains the provisions for the certification of public water supply system operators.
Chapter 82 contains the provisions for the certification of water well contractors.
Chapter 83 contains the provisions for the certification of laboratories to provide environmental testing of drinking water supplies.
